Delete/Remove Window.old Folder After Upgrading to Windows 8

Posted on 09:25 by Unknown

Windows.old folder deletionHave you upgraded your previous Windows version(Windows operating system like XP/Vista or Seven) to Windows 8?. if you are going to do this, then first check your pc compatibility. If you are previously using Windows 8 Developer/Consumer Preview it is as easy as running the upgrading. After the Windows 8 upgrade you will notice that your free space on your hard drive(specially C: drive) has diminished by quite a lot. That is due to your old windows directory(previous windows version system files) has been moved to a folder at C:\Windows.old folder by the Windows 8 upgrade setup.  Hard disk space used by this folder can be empty by deleting this unnecessary folder. Windows does include a utility to help you get rid of this bulky folder forever.

Fix Blogger Comments Grammatical Mistake

Posted on 07:56 by Unknown

Blogger CommentsCouples of blogs are added everyday with different subjects on internet. When any post of your blog has not any comment or when you publish your new post in your blog, you will find your blog’s comment label will be displayed as “0 Comments”. When a user will comment in your new post which has not any comment, You will see “1 Comments. So you think that what is wrong with that. Let’s come to the point. As English Grammar the label “0 comments” or “1 Comments” are wrong. If one of our blog has no comment then comment label should be displayed as “0 Comment” not “0 Comments”. And also if a blog has only one comment then comment label should be displayed as “1 Comment” not “1 Comments”. The words “0 Comments” and “1 Comments” have totally wrong and mismatched meanings. So now I am going to explain how can we get ride of this grammatical mistake and fix with meaningful words as “0 Comment” and “1 Comments”.
